Job Title: Supply Chain Assistant

Job Code: SCM001
Location: Abuja

Specific Objectives

  • Responsible for analyzing program information, discuss findings and provide feedback to stakeholders and program teams on Support all raising of requisition from various units in terms of specifications and quantification.   
  • Manage and update Requisition Tracker (Approved Purchase Request)
  • Responsible for managing and updating Procurement transaction trackers
  • Manage and update data base for market survey for snap shot reference.
  • Support all SCM Secretariat activities like flow of memo across all review and approval levels and ensure timely feedback on queried document.
  • Support both the SCM Officer and the Associate on all task assigned; Bid review documentation, generation of purchase orders, and raising balance payment for all completed transactions.

Qualifications, Knowledge, Skills & Ability

  • Bachelor's Degree in Science or Social Sciences. 2 years’ experience. 1 year working experience in donor funded agencies. Knowledge of MS Word, Excel and Access required;
  • Demonstrated ability to work cooperatively as a member of a team.
